Web1 mei 2024 · How many steps is 60 minutes of walking? Using the same steps per mile calculation as before, at 3 mph a 6’0″ person takes about 2,000 steps per mile while a 5’0″ person takes about 2,500 steps. That 60 minute walk would cover about 3 miles, giving you between 6,000 and 7,500 steps. You can estimate around 6,600-7,000 to be safe.
